Idiopathic tremor is the most common dyskinesia, mainly postural and motor tremor of hand, head and other parts of the body. Idiopathic tremor has contradictory clinical essence. On the one hand, it is a mild single symptom disease; on the other hand, it is a common progressive disease with significant clinical variation. Idiopathic tremor? Age of onset is not associated with prognosis, and tremor severity is not associated with mortality. Although idiopathic tremor is often rated as "benign" and is in a stable state for a long time or for a lifetime, some patients with severe tremor will lead to difficulty in activities, reduce social interaction activities, and eventually lose labor force and self-care difficulties. This kind of situation generally occurs more than ten years after onset, and the incidence increases with age. As many as 15% of patients may retire early due to incapacity.
